How do I use my insurance policy number to file a claim?

Your insurance policy number is a crucial identifier when filing a claim. You'll use it to locate your account with the insurance company and ensure your claim is processed correctly. This number is typically required on all claim forms, when speaking with a claims representative, and when accessing your policy information online.

Filing an insurance claim involves several steps where your policy number will be essential. First, you'll need to obtain the necessary claim form, which can often be downloaded from your insurer's website or requested through their customer service line. The claim form will invariably ask for your policy number. Fill out the form accurately and completely, providing all the details requested about the incident that led to the claim. Omitting or providing incorrect information, especially the policy number, can delay or even invalidate your claim. After completing the form, you'll need to submit it along with any supporting documentation, such as photos, police reports, medical records, or repair estimates. When submitting these documents, clearly include your policy number on each page or document for easy reference. If you're submitting the claim online, the website will typically have a designated field for your policy number. Similarly, if you're mailing in your claim, write your policy number clearly on the outside of the envelope. Remember to keep a copy of the claim form and all supporting documents for your records.

What happens if I lose my insurance policy number?

Losing your insurance policy number doesn't mean your coverage disappears. Your policy remains active, and your insurance company maintains a record of it. You can easily retrieve your policy number by contacting your insurance company directly, either by phone, online through their website or app, or by checking old insurance documents like renewal notices or premium payment receipts.

While the loss of your policy number doesn't affect your coverage, having it readily available is beneficial. It speeds up the process when you need to file a claim, make inquiries about your policy, or provide proof of insurance. Think of it like your account number for other services – it identifies you and your specific coverage details within the insurer's system. To avoid future inconvenience, consider taking steps to keep your policy number accessible. You can store it securely in your phone, password manager, or a safe physical location along with other important documents. Most insurance companies also offer digital access to policy documents, including your policy number, through their online portals or mobile apps.
